Rep Seeks New Technical and Entrepreneurship Colleges in Kebbi

A member of the House of Representatives, Ibrahim Mohammed, has introduced two bills aimed at setting up new educational institutions in Kebbi State to address unemployment and improve practical training for youths.

The lawmaker, who represents Birnin Kebbi/Kalgo/Bunza Federal Constituency, is pushing for the creation of the Federal College of Entrepreneurship and Skills Acquisition in Bunza and the National Institute for Technical and Vocational Education in Kalgo.

He explained that the move is part of his plans to give young people the skills they need to thrive in today’s job market.

According to him, both colleges are expected to serve as learning hubs where students can gain hands-on experience in areas such as technology, applied sciences, entrepreneurship, the arts, and vocational fields.

The announcement comes ahead of a public hearing set for Thursday at the House of Representatives, where stakeholders from various sectors are expected to attend.

Mohammed stated that the institutions will be fully funded by the federal government and have their own governing councils.

They will offer diplomas, NCEs, and professional certificates, providing students with a wide range of qualifications that are useful for the job market or for starting their own businesses.

The college in Bunza will focus on entrepreneurship, teacher training, and skill-building for self-employment, while the institute in Kalgo will focus on advanced technical education and research in line with industry needs.

He believes this step will not only benefit Kebbi but also contribute to national development by preparing a workforce that can meet the country’s evolving challenges.
